Silgan Holdings (SLGN) has experienced a notable financial recovery, prompting an upgrade from a 'sell' to a 'hold' rating. This turnaround is largely due to the strategic acquisition of Weener Packaging, strong performance within its Dispensing and Specialty Closures division, and effective cost-saving measures. While the company anticipates continued growth in both revenue and profitability, its stock price remains relatively high when compared to its competitors, leading to a cautious 'hold' stance given broader economic conditions.
